Costuming stage and the entertainers of Hollywood was a passionate love affair Tuesday had with her career. From the start of an idea through the final creation and production her work has been dedicated to enhancing the quality of an actor's performance, providing both costume and believability to actor and audience for the most enjoyable entertaining experience. Tuesday had the privilege to costume Broadway shows, television, film, recording artist and tours across the world. Worn by Hollywood celebrities Tuesday Conner Designs have been captured in concert, printed in magazines and created for some of Europe and Hollywood's hottest Premieres and Award shows until she followed her heart and changed her career path. Tuesday is now a Writer and Producer enjoying Hollywood from a new point of view; but, couldn't abandon her passion. So, she teaches all she knows to anyone with the desire to sew. Her Students range from 7 years old to adults and she'll come to your home for private lessons to teach you pattern making, designing and sewing.

Jan, 1986ASG is a membership organization that welcomes sewing enthusiasts of all skill levels and from many different walks of life. Chapters are located in cities all across the country and members meet monthly to learn new sewing skills, network with others who share an interest in sewing and participate in community service sewing projects. Membership in the Guild gives you an opportunity to experience your love of any type of home sewing with others who share your interest.

Sep, 2017SAG-AFTRA represents approximately 160,000 actors, announcers, broadcast journalists, dancers, DJs, news writers, news editors, program hosts, puppeteers, recording artists, singers, stunt performers, voiceover artists and other media professionals. SAG-AFTRA members are the faces and voices that entertain and inform America and the world. With national offices in Los Angeles and New York, and local offices nationwide, SAG-AFTRA members work together to secure the strongest protections for media artists into the 21st century and beyond.
